Louisvale's reputation for quality is built
on its Chardonnay. No fewer than 11 successive vintages have
been selected for the annual Nederburg Auction - an
unsurpassed record for Chardonnay and proof of their wine's
superior status. Says Louisvale Cellar Master Simon Smith: "We
are winemakers and not carpenters and our Chardonnays reflect
terroir characteristics that are well supported by effective
wood management".
The dynamic management team of the property, spearheaded by
Chief Executive Anzill Adams, intends to concentrate mainly on
three different Chardonnays - Louisvale Unwooded (maiden
vintage), Louisvale Chavant (now introduced as "Lightly
Oaked") and the already well established Louisvale Reserve
Chardonnay range - to reposition Louisvale as a Chardonnay
specialist producer. The only red wine will be the Louisvale
Dominique - a top class Bordeaux style blend made of Cabernet
Sauvignon, Merlot and Cabernet Franc. |
